Third-year Pittsburgh Steelers offensive tackle Broderick Jones is making the switch from right tackle to left tackle in an effort to not only plug a hole for the Black and Gold but start to fulfill the potential he had coming out of Georgia.
He’s back at left tackle, the position he played in college and had the Steelers trade up to land him in the first round of the 2023 NFL Draft to fortify. Though he took a detour for two years to right tackle and played nearly 2,000 snaps at the position, he’s back on the left side.
